Founded in 1948, Construction Specialties (CS) is a specialty building products manufacturer. CS provides solutions to building challenges that architects, designers, building owners, facility managers, and contractors face every day. Since inventing the first extruded louver, CS has become a global leader in all our product categories. Our products are a part of some of the most iconic buildings around the world—from the world’s tallest tower, Burj Khalifa in Dubai, to the Oculus at the World Trade Center Transit Hub in Manhattan.
About the role
The Senior Program Account Sales role is responsible for driving revenue growth, customer retention, and program expansion across a defined portfolio of program-based accounts. This position serves as the primary commercial leader for assigned customers, owning the relationship, identifying opportunities for growth, and ensuring alignment between customer needs and company capabilities. The role operates in close partnership with the Manager, Program Accounts, who leads the internal execution teams responsible for account management, inside sales, and customer service. The Senior Program Account Sales professional is accountable for developing and advancing opportunities, maintaining strong customer relationships, and ensuring that revenue objectives are achieved through disciplined pipeline management and consistent customer engagement.
